‘Höegh Gallant’ chartered by Clearlake Shipping

According to the latest Reuters report, Gunvor’s Clearlake Shipping has chartered the Höegh Gallant from Höegh LNG. The vessel will serve Clearlake as an LNG carrier.
The Höegh Gallant is by design a floating regasification and storage unit (FSRU), however it can also serve as a standard LNG carrier. As a carrier, the vessel has a capacity of 170 000 m3.
The Höegh Gallant recently departed the Suez Canal after its contract in Egypt ended. It is now heading for Sabine Pass LNG export terminal in Louisiana. It is set to arrive on 6 November.
